What is Shipping Container Construction?
Shipping Container Solutions container construction includes using intermodal containers, commonly referred to as shipping containers, as the primary structure product. These robust metal boxes are created to endure extreme conditions at sea, making them resilient and sustainable for construction functions. The versatility of shipping containers enables imaginative designs in architecture, contributing to a wide range of applications.

Sustainability
Using repurposed containers minimizes waste, as many containers stay unused or abandoned after their preliminary shipping service. This practice is not just eco-friendly but is likewise a wise way to reduce the carbon footprint connected with conventional building products.
2. Price
Shipping container homes or structures can supply substantial cost savings compared to standard construction approaches. The containers themselves can frequently be bought at a portion of the cost of standard structure products. Moreover, their modular design can minimize labor expenses and construction time.
3. Fast Construction
Container construction permits for faster conclusion times. Numerous parts, such as insulation, pipes, and electrical systems, can be upraised in a factory before being transported and assembled on-site. This can considerably reduce the general task timeline.
4. Design Versatility
Containers can be stacked, integrated, and tailored according to particular requirements. Architectural imagination can thrive with shipping containers, resulting in distinct and innovative structures. This technique allows architects and builders to think outside the box-- literally!
5. Movement
Shipping container structures can be transported easily, permitting moving if essential. This quality is especially helpful for momentary tasks or mobile organizations like food trucks or pop-up events.
6. Sturdiness
Shipping containers are designed to sustain the rigors of sea travel, making them exceptionally resilient. They can hold up against severe weather and require very little maintenance, ensuring longevity.
7. Security
The robust steel structure of shipping containers offers excellent security versus theft or vandalism. They can be fitted with locks and security systems, making them a safe alternative for storage or living areas.
Difficulties of Shipping Container Construction1. Building Regulations and Regulations
Regional building regulations can sometimes hinder container construction due to zoning restrictions or safety concerns. It is crucial to examine with regional authorities relating to guidelines before beginning a job.
2. Insulation and Temperature Control
Metal containers can be prone to extreme heat in summertime and cold in winter. Proper insulation and ventilation systems are necessary to make sure comfy living and working conditions.
3. Structural Modifications
Cutting and modifying containers for windows, doors, and internal designs needs cautious planning and execution. It is important to preserve structural stability while creating for performance.
4. Restricted Financing Options
Regardless of lower costs, some banks may be hesitant to finance shipping container tasks due to their non-traditional nature. Finding lending institutions knowledgeable about container construction may present a challenge.
Process of Shipping Container Construction1. Preparation and Design
Before beginning any project, detailed preparation and design are vital. This phase includes figuring out the function of the structure, choosing the type and number of containers, and designing the layout.
2. Acquisition of Containers
Containers can be sourced from shipping companies, container dealers, or online markets. Inspecting containers for structural integrity and evaluating any essential repairs is important.
3. Site Preparation
Preparing the construction website may include grading, leveling, and laying a structure. While containers are sturdy, a solid base is typically advised to assist in drain.
4. Modifications and Customizations
This phase involves cutting the containers for doors, windows, and other openings, in addition to adding insulation or soundproofing materials. Plumbing, electrical, and framing work are normally completed at this point.
5. Assembly
Containers are transported to the site and placed in their predetermined plan. At this stage, structural connections are made, and additional parts are installed.
6. Finishing Touches
The last of the procedure involves interior and exterior finishing work, including painting, flooring, cabinetry, and landscaping to produce a complete and functional living or work area.
Frequently Asked Questions (FAQ)Q1. Are shipping container homes legal to construct?
A1. Structure codes and zoning laws differ by location. Constantly examine local guidelines and obtain essential licenses before starting construction.
Q2. How much does it cost to construct a shipping container home?
A2. The cost can differ commonly depending on the size, design, place, and personalization. Basic container homes can begin around ₤ 10,000, while more elaborate styles can surpass ₤ 100,000.
Q3. The number of shipping containers do I need?
A3. The variety of containers needed will depend upon the preferred size and layout of the structure. A small single-container home can be adequate, while bigger structures might require numerous containers.
Q4. Can I finance a shipping container job?
A4. Financing choices might be restricted. It's recommended to research study loan providers who have experience with unconventional building methods.
Q5. How are shipping container homes insulated?
A5. Insulation can be used inside or outside the container. Products like spray foam, stiff foam, or wool can provide efficient insulation and contribute to energy efficiency.
